76ers vs Heat Monday Prediction | NBA Picks Today, Best Bets

The Philadelphia 76ers are set for an Eastern Conference showdown against the Miami Heat on Monday night. Philadelphia enters this matchup looking to snap its 11-game losing streak with its depleted roster. Meanwhile, the Heat enters this matchup hoping to get back on track after cooling down from its recent winning streak in a big way with back-to-back losses. Regardless, expect both teams to put forth their best effort to get back in the win column.

76ers vs Heat

  • Location: Kaseya Center – Miami, Floria
  • Where to Watch: NBA League Pass
  • Time: 7:30 p.m. ET
  • Spread: Heat -14.5 | Total: 214
  • Moneyline: Heat -1200 | 76ers +750

76ers vs Heat Best Bet: 76ers +14.5

The 76ers enter this matchup as heavy underdogs on the road, and considering the number of injuries on Nick Nurse’s roster, it doesn’t come as a surprise. However, despite their poor record and laundry list of an injury report, Philadelphia’s coaching staff has done a good job throughout the season putting their reserve players in the mindset to continue playing hard. Although I don’t see any scenario in which Philadelphia steals a win on the road, it wouldn’t shock me if the Sixers kept the deficit under 15 points.

76ers vs Heat Best Total Bet: Over 214

Miami leads the season series against the 76ers 3-0 entering this matchup. In their most recent battle, the Heat steamrolled the Sixers 118-95 in a one-sided scoring bout. It wouldn’t be shocking to see the game script unfold similarly this time, with Miami doing most of the scoring to exceed the 214-point set total. However, I like the chance that Philadelphia keeps this matchup closer. A final score of 121-109 seems like a realistic outcome.

76ers Best Player Bet: Lonnie Walker IV 20+ Points +420

After spending most of the season overseas, Lonnie Walker IV signed with the 76ers in the buyout market. The fact that the versatile guard couldn’t find a spot on an NBA roster was a head scratcher to many, including himself. Since joining Philadelphia, the Miami product continues to carry that chip on his shoulder, looking to prove his doubters wrong. Considering Walker IV is coming off an 18-point performance and returning to the area where he played college basketball, I like the chance that the playmaker puts together a big performance on the road.

Heat Best Player Bet: Tyler Herro 4+ Threes +172

Tyler Herro is undoubtedly one of the best shooters in the league, and he proved that this season by winning the 2025 3-point Contest at NBA All-Star Weekend. The Kentucky product is shooting 37.3% from downtown, averaging 8.9 attempts from beyond the arc per game. Fresh off a 35-point night in his last matchup, where he drained four threes, I can easily see the Heat star putting together a strong shooting night to help lift his team over Philadelphia.
